So looking on the calendar, I don't see the date and time of the next game showing up. I'm not sure how to get it to show on the calendar.
Use the "Suggest new game time" section on the right of the calendar. Fill in the numerical day and month, with time in 24 hour or with am/pm in the format HH:MM, e.g. 20:00 or 8:00pm

Make sure you, and the players, have their time zone set in their user profile page. Then the date/time should adjust for your own time zone.
